SUPER EAGLES DEPART NIGERIA FOR LONDON, TO PLAY ENGLAND FRIENDLY
Nigeria’s Super Eagles left Nigeria on Wednesday afternoon to the United Kingdom, in preparation for the 2018 FIFA World Cup, which kicks off on June 14 in Russia.
Nigeria will play with England on Saturday, June 2 and then leave for Austria before embarking on the journey to Russia, where they will face Croatia on June 16.
According to NFF.com, Skipper Mikel John Obi was joined on the chartered flight from Abuja to London on Wednesday by deputy skipper Ogenyi Onazi, defender Kenneth Omeruo, pacy winger Ahmed Musa and 21 other players.

MOHAMED SALAH NOT ‘ANGRY’ WITH SERGIO RAMOS
Mohamed Salah is not “angry” with Sergio Ramos over the tackle that has put his World Cup hopes in jeopardy.
Salah was injured after a tangle with Ramos in the Champions League final at the weekend.
The pair locked arms as they fell to the ground, with Salah taking the brunt of the weight on his shoulder.

ROBERT LEWANDOWSKI WANTS TO LEAVE BAYERN – AGENT
The agent of Bayern Munich striker Robert Lewandowski – a reported transfer target for Real Madrid – has said his client wishes to leave the club.
The Poland international joined the Bavarians from Borussia Dortmund in 2014 and has since netted 151 goals in 195 appearances, winning four successive league titles.
“Robert feels that he needs a change and a new challenge in his career,” Pini Zahavi, the striker’s agent, is cited in quotes carried by Associated Press.

ENGLAND’S JORDAN PICKFORD: I’M READY TO TAKE WORLD CUP SHOOTOUT PENALTY
Goalkeeper Jordan Pickford has said he is ready to take a crucial penalty in a World Cup shootout for England and revealed that the players have had mock shootouts, with players walking from the halfway line to re-create the matchday process.
Everton’s Pickford said he was as prepared to try his luck from the spot as he was to make a match-winning save.
“If I need to step up, I’ll take one. I’ve got no issue with that,” the 24-year-old said at St George’s Park.
